Hillendale Country Club has been a fixture of the Baltimore-area private golf scene for decades, occupying the rolling countryside of northern Baltimore County just outside the small community of Phoenix. The club carries the kind of quiet prestige associated with Maryland's older established clubs — a members' world largely shielded from public view, built around a course that rewards those who know it well.
The terrain here is classic Piedmont Maryland: gently folded hills, mature hardwoods, and the kind of open farmland that transitions into wooded corridors as you move away from the Chesapeake coastal plain. That landscape typically produces courses with natural elevation changes, tree-lined fairways, and greens that sit at angles designed to complicate approach shots. A par 72 layout in this setting tends to ask for patience and course management rather than raw distance.
Phoenix sits in a stretch of Baltimore County that has long attracted established families and old-money country club culture. Hillendale fits that tradition — a private membership club where the golf is the draw, but the community around it is equally the point.
| Tee | Yards | Rating | Slope | Par |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Black · men | 6,845 | 73.7 | 136 | 72 |
| Blue · men | 6,454 | 71.9 | 132 | 72 |
| Blue/White · men | 6,108 | 70 | 130 | 72 |
| White · men | 5,786 | 68.4 | 124 | 72 |
| White · women | 5,786 | 73.5 | 136 | 73 |
| Red · men | 5,104 | 65.3 | 112 | 72 |
| Red · women | 5,104 | 71.1 | 127 | 73 |
